2.monotouch 控件的使用
1.我们打开一个xib
右下角会看到如下图所示:
这一部分包含了界面和各种各样的控件。选取一个控件,使用鼠标拖动到界面上即可使用。
2.选中一个控件,该控件的相关信息会在右边进行显示。做出相关设置即可。
3.设置控件属性和绑定控件事件。
首先打开开该xib的Editor,打开方法点击右上角Editor区域。如图:
选中控件,按着右键不放,鼠标拖动到打开的*.h的界面。会弹出如图:
Connection的下拉列表选项,Outlet 指的是属性,Action 指的就是事件。
点击Connect会在解决方案下对应的*.designer.cs文件中生成属性和事件。
designer.cs:
[Action ("btnBack_Click:")]
partial void btnBack_Click (MonoTouch.Foundation.NSObject sender);
如果designer.cs中有事件的声明,就必须在cs中进行事例化,此过程是手动实现,monotouch不会自动实现。
cs:
partial void btnBack_Click (MonoTouch.Foundation.NSObject sender)
{
}
此处就是使用的控件的方法。
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】凌霞软件回馈社区,博客园 & 1Panel & Halo 联合会员上线
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】博客园社区专享云产品让利特惠,阿里云新客6.5折上折
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步